Classy, an affiliate of GoFundMe, is a Public Benefit Corporation and giving platform that enables nonprofits to connect supporters with the causes they care about. Classy's platform provides powerful and intuitive fundraising tools to convert and retain donors. Since 2011, Classy has helped nonprofits mobilize and empower the world for good by helping them raise over $7 billion. Classy also hosts the Collaborative conference and the Classy Awards to spotlight the innovative work nonprofits are implementing around the globe. For more information, visit www.classy.org.
Classy’s Professional Services Team is looking for an experienced Project Manager who will be responsible for managing implementations for our strategic customer accounts. The ideal candidate for this role is a detail-oriented customer advocate with experience delivering high quality, on-time SaaS implementations.
The Job…
- Deliver exceptional customer implementations for Classy’s fundraising and events platform
- Manage projects end-to-end, which includes scoping, planning, execution, risk/issue mitigation and stakeholder management
- Gather information from customers to evaluate their needs and create tailored implementation plans that support business objectives
- Work with customer and internal teams to translate requirements into out of the box or custom solutions
- Execute client implementation projects with sole responsibility for deliverables, overall project success, exceptional customer experience
- Deliver “hands on keyboard” configuration of customer instance, configuration and asset creation as required for completion of project
- Identify, mitigate, monitor and communicate project risks and scope changes that may arise during the implementation
- Provide strategic guidance and training for customers through platform implementation and campaign development - ensure client campaigns and events are optimized for success, launch on time, and achieve donation volume and other customer business goals
- Build and maintain strong relationships with all internal and external project stakeholders
- Develop Classy product and non-profit industry subject matter expertise
- Manage resource planning and utilization
- Collaborate with Tech Services, Customer Care, and Account Teams to ensure a successful onboarding experience and adoption of the Classy platform
- Contribute to team goals and initiatives through participation in team meetings, collaborate on / take ownership of projects driving process improvement, team enablement, etc.
- Identify areas of challenge or opportunity for increased quality of delivery and take initiative to develop solutions, in partnership with team members / leadership, as needed
